All Too Well functions as a chef-driven neighborhood sandwich shop and market, with a tight menu of composed sandwiches built on schiacciata and ciabatta. Portions are generous and ingredient-driven, so locals treat it as a special lunch move before or after walks to the zoo or lake.
Must-Try Dishes:
Ck1 (Shaved Ribeye Sandwich), Bombay Chulet, "...I Make You Lamb" Sandwich

What makes it special: A daytime sandwich counter where chef-y combinations like the CK1 and Bombay Chulet make lunch feel like an event.
Who should go: Lunch people chasing maximal, chef-driven sandwich builds.
When to visit: Weekday or early weekend lunch before peak rush.
What to order: Ck1, Bombay Chulet, ...I Make You Lamb.
Insider tip: Order ahead online on busy weekends—most seating goes fast and to-go orders dominate.
